Northwestern Formula Racing (Formula SAE)

Founded in 2006, this undergraduate organization designs and builds racecars from scratch to compete in the Formula SAE race, organized by the Society of Automotive Engineers.

Baja SAE Team

Baja SAE students design and build off-road vehicles that can survive the punishment of rough terrain. Since 1988, Northwestern’s Baja SAE Team has competed in Baja-style races sponsored by the Society of Automotive Engineers. The team actively seeks new undergraduate members.

Northwestern University Solar Car Team (NUsolar)

NUsolar is an undergraduate student organization that designs, builds, and races solar-powered vehicles. Since it is completely student-run, team members take on a wide spectrum of responsibilities, including engineering, manufacturing, operations, marketing, and finance.

Segal Professional Bridge (SPB)

The Segal Professional Bridge group connects graduate and undergraduate students affiliated with the Segal Design Institute with like-minded professionals and students from other schools who are passionate about the broad field of design. SPB hosts networking events, workshops, and presentations on campus throughout the academic year.

Design Competition

Every year, teams of undergraduates from different departments come together to build robots and compete for prizes. Student teams design, build, and program their robots independently before setting their creations loose on a pre-determined track during the spring competition.

EPIC

This student-run, interdisciplinary group connects entrepreneurship resources throughout Northwestern. EPIC sponsors competitions, coordinates special events, and provides general support for entrepreneurial students.

Design for America (DFA)

Design for America (DFA) is an award-winning nationwide network of interdisciplinary student teams and community members using design to create local and social impact. DFA teaches human centered design to young adults and collaborating community partners through extra-curricular, university based, student led design studios to look locally, create fervently and act fearlessly. Engineers for a Sustainable World (ESW)

ESW at Northwestern mobilizes engineers through education, training, and practical action while building collaborative partnerships to meet the needs of current and future generations. Through educational outreach and action-based projects, the organization empowers undergraduates to take on leadership roles in applying sustainability principles to their work.

3D4E

3D4E (3D printing for everyone) is Northwestern's first student organization dedicated to 3D printing and computer-aided design education. 3D4E members come together from a diverse set of backgrounds to tackle projects, hold workshops, and spread the experience of designing and creating using approachable technology through 3D printing.
